Question:
Is it the intention of the reading of this, that all buildings equipped with a garage shall have a dedicated circuit for an electric vehicle use only?
-
Comments:
When a home is built under this code, does the home have to have a dedicated circuit for this vehicle only, along with the other already required dedicated circuits for the garage under NEC/FBC
FBC Code Reference Chapter 37
E3702.13 Electric vehicle branch circuit.
Outlets installed for the purpose of charging electric vehicles shall be supplied by a separate branch circuit. Such circuit shall not supply other outlets. (210.17)
